UK weather: More than half a month’s rain to fall in southern parts of UK BBC Sports says More than half a month’s rain could fall across the south of England on Friday leading to a chance of flooding, the Met Office has warned. Around 30mm to 40mm (1 to 1.5in) of rain is expected to fall in some areas in just six hours, forecasters say. Usually in August, 63mm (2.5in) of rain falls across south-east England during the entire month. Wet weather dampens retail sales in Great Britain The Guardian says Wet weather has been blamed for a worse-than-expected fall in retail sales last month, with households in Great Britain shunning the high street and pulling back on clothes purchases. Official figures showed that the quantity of goods bought fell 1.2% month on month in July, worse than average analyst forecasts of a 0.5% drop in sales volumes. It follows a 0.6% rise in June.
